keep32 发表于 2015-11-8 14:02:27

stm32驱动tft工程移植后调试失败

板子用的神舟三号STM32F103ZE,液晶ili9320,开发环境keil4
1、开发板带的例程(清屏红色)可用
2、自己新建一个工程,将例程中的代码复制过来,编译无错误,无警告,但下载后液晶不显示,
3、利用debug,发现程序不能全速运行,点一下RUN,短暂运行后自动停止,发现没进入main(已勾选run to main),汇编界面卡在如图所示位置 http://bbs.elecfans.com/data/attachment/forum/201511/07/174214kzwivicvwi6xxqmm.png
请教各位大神是哪的问题?工程配置?程序有误?

aabird 发表于 2015-11-8 15:38:15

这个不会吧,确实没遇到过。支持

keep32 发表于 2015-11-8 17:06:20

已解决
源程序中9320初始化中有一句printf,会使stm工作在半主机模式下,这时需在Target中勾选use Microlib,
或者直接屏蔽掉printf

keep32 发表于 2015-11-8 17:06:42

aabird 发表于 2015-11-8 15:38
这个不会吧,确实没遇到过。支持

谢谢支持:handshake

dsjsjf 发表于 2015-11-8 17:39:00

帮顶      

65536 发表于 2015-11-9 09:13:39

帮顶 仔细检查
页: [1]
查看完整版本: stm32驱动tft工程移植后调试失败